Problem

Existing methods for determining the internal resistance of battery cells in direct battery converters disrupt the output voltage, making them unsuitable for arbitrary use with inverters and electric machines, and can lead to operational issues.

Innovation Solution

A method where a first battery module is decoupled and connected to the battery string, with a matching number of second modules decoupled to maintain voltage stability, allowing for precise determination of internal resistance without altering the output voltage, using a step-like current excitation and voltage response evaluation.

AI summary

The invention relates to a method for determining the internal resistance of battery cells of battery modules (220, 230) of a battery (100) that can be connected to an electric motor (60), said modules being arranged in at least one battery bank (110). In order to generate an adjustable output voltage (UB) for the battery (100), each battery module (220, 230) is designed to be connected in series to the battery bank (110) of the battery (100) and to be decoupled from said bank (110). According to the invention, during the operation of the electric motor (60) at least one first battery module (220) that has been decoupled from the battery bank (110) is connected to said bank (110) and the internal resistance of the battery cells of at least one first connected battery module (220) is determined. In addition, at the same time as the first battery module (220) is connected, a sufficient number of second battery modules (230) that are connected to the battery bank (110) and generate a voltage (UM) corresponding to the voltage (UM) generated by the first connected battery module (220) within predefined tolerance limits are decoupled from the battery bank (110).
